Use ddsrt_malloc in macOS socket waitset code

Signed-off-by: Erik Boasson <eb@ilities.com>
This commit is contained in:
Erik Boasson 2019-06-24 09:58:58 +02:00 committed by eboasson
parent 12d2a82823
commit 0b8fd9fcc0

View file

@ -118,7 +118,7 @@ os_sockWaitset os_sockWaitsetNew (void)
ws->ctx.nevs = 0; ws->ctx.nevs = 0;
ws->ctx.index = 0; ws->ctx.index = 0;
ws->ctx.evs_sz = sz; ws->ctx.evs_sz = sz;
if ((ws->ctx.evs = malloc (ws->ctx.evs_sz * sizeof (*ws->ctx.evs))) == NULL) if ((ws->ctx.evs = ddsrt_malloc (ws->ctx.evs_sz * sizeof (*ws->ctx.evs))) == NULL)
goto fail_ctx_evs; goto fail_ctx_evs;
if ((ws->kqueue = kqueue ()) == -1) if ((ws->kqueue = kqueue ()) == -1)
goto fail_kqueue; goto fail_kqueue;